Since falling below $54,000 earlier on Friday, the price of the world's largest cryptocurrency has seen a moderate rebound, currently trading at $58,283. According to data compiled by Farside Investors, the net inflow of the US Bitcoin ETF on Friday was $143.1 million, the highest level in at least two weeks. The fund with the highest net inflow was the WiseOrigin Bitcoin Fund (FBTC) under Fidelity, with a net inflow of $117.4 million. Other funds with net inflows include Bitwise Bitcoin ETF (BITB), ARK/21 Shares Bitcoin ETF (ARKB), and VanEck Bitcoin Trust (HODL).
